Rick Kelly

Facility and Environment, Health and Safety Mgr, Lawrence Berkeley National Laboratory, Berkeley, CA

Rick Kelly is the Facility and Environment, Health and Safety Manager for the Materials Sciences Division at the Lawrence Berkeley National Laboratory in Berkeley California. Rick and his staff recently managed the transition to operation of the Molecular Foundry, one of the five Department of Energy Nanoscale Science Research Centers (NSRCs). He is Chair of the DOE ES&H committee that developed comprehensive guidance for the safe handling of nanoscale materials of uncertain toxicity. Rick is certified in the comprehensive practice of industrial hygiene and has a Masters Degree in Industrial Hygiene from the University of Cincinnati.
